Health Care Select Sector SPDR Fund (XLV) Offers Diversified Exposure to U.S. Healthcare Sector

The Health Care Select Sector SPDR Fund (XLV) has emerged as a significant investment vehicle for those seeking to diversify their portfolios within the U.S. healthcare sector. By tracking healthcare stocks within the S&P 500 Index, XLV offers investors broad exposure to foundational companies that are central to America's healthcare industry.

XLV's holdings span a diverse range of healthcare sub-sectors, including pharmaceuticals, health insurance, medical devices, and diagnostics. This comprehensive approach allows investors to gain exposure to multiple facets of the healthcare industry through a single fund. As of July 31, 2024, the fund's top holdings include industry giants such as Eli Lilly (11.66%), UnitedHealth (9.63%), and Johnson & Johnson (6.90%), among others.

It is important to note that while XLV offers diversification within the healthcare sector, it is subject to sector-specific risks and non-diversification risk, which may result in greater price fluctuations compared to the overall market. Investors should carefully consider their investment objectives, risks, charges, and expenses before investing in any ETF.

The Health Care Select Sector SPDR Fund (XLV) is part of the Select Sector SPDR ETFs family, which aims to provide investors with flexibility and customization opportunities in their investment strategies. These ETFs allow investors to select sectors that best align with their investment goals, recognizing that while many investors may have similar outlooks, individual investment needs can vary.
